The Employment and Labour Relations Court has ordered Del Monte Kenya Limited to pay a former employee Sh1.2 million for wrongful dismissal.

Documents filed in court indicate Moses Omutanyi Mumia, then a general field worker, was dismissed from the pineapple processing company in 2013, after working for 12 years, after the firm allegedly discovered a Sh5 million loss in its books of accounts.

The court heard that Mumia's job included receiving pineapples from the farm supervisor, weighing them and issuing them to customers as per orders given by the sales supervisor.

Justice Byram Ongaya yesterday noted that the company had failed to establish the plaintiff failed to perform any of the duties he was supposed to perform.
